mounting spotlamps

New to this forum,hope you can help,i want to mount spotlamps to my Fiesta,it has plastic bumpers and the brackets look as if they should mount directly to the car body.I'm old school so how can i mount the brackets on to the bumper?Will i need to drill the bumper,or remove the bumper to attach the brackets to the car.Thank you in advance

Out here you can get a bracket that mounts to the licence plate mount - not for huge lights but ok for 'normal' size ones
